Arsenal hero Martin Keown expects the stars to stay should they miss out on a top four finish.
The Gunners need victory at Newcastle United to be sure of fourth place.
Keown told the Daily Mail: "I don't think so. The difference is that being in the Champions League can help Arsenal attract even better players.
"Yes, they've lost Robin van Persie, Cesc Fabregas, Alex Song, Gael Clichy and Samir Nasri in recent summers, but I don't see a repeat of that regardless of where they finish. Jack Wilshere is the jewel in the crown, but he won't leave.
"The team has to be built around him. Some players might be in danger of leaving if they miss out, but only because the manager will want to be straight back in the top four next season."
